how do i remove the front diff on my arrma kraton rxb rtr? it wont come out

Judging by the shim, something blew up inside, putting a lot of pressure on the bearings. You may need to pry it out with something. Screwdriver?

It went in there....it'll come out.
 
Might be that the EXB diff cups are bigger than the regular V5 cups & need to remove the two lower shock tower screws that screw into the bulkhead right at the cups. Looks like they are hitting the heads of the bolts. My V3 & V5, I have to wiggle on it and turn the shafts some & turn the diff & it'll come out, when I think it won't. But those cups are smaller. EXB are little bigger on the size.

I find when trying to get around those two lower screws on the shock mount plate...I need to turn those outdrives on each side where the flat side of the outdrive on each side can pass under those two screws. Then, walk it like a duck to move it forward.

Also, make sure nothing on the shock areas is blocking the drivetrain arms from moving forward. Shocks are removed, etc, so the drivetrain can move forward.
